  Equipotential Earthing System

Earthing precautions against effects of lightning: A high voltage earthing installation should be used for protection from lightning. The resistance and inductance of the discharging way to earth of all over voltage protection arrangements must be kept little insofar as possible. Therefore, connection to the earthing electrode should be straight, without angled and from the shortest way.

Regarding earthing precautions for buildings against effects of lightning the relevant standards (TS 622,TS IEC 61024 and TS IEC 60364-4-443 etc.) and the subjects taken place in other relevant legislation (Lightning conductor installation section in Technical Works Specification of Ministry of Public Works, etc.) shall be observed.

For additional earthing precautions to be taken in flammable and explosive environments the subjects stated in the relevant standards (for example; EN 60079-14), regulations and circulars shall be observed.

The most secured system in earthing is the equipotential system. In this system all earthings, all metal sections are engaged one another with equipotential bars. Thus, the voltage difference that may occur at any two points within the plant is prevented and equipotentiality at all points is provided. The surge arrestors' products (Overvoltage Strike Pad) shall also be used in this system, due to the requirements to take precautions against the overvoltages to be made by the system while engaging the lightning system to the equipotential system. Otherwise, this system provides a big danger for devices. When connecting different earthings, connection should be made over equipotential materials.
